The Top Payroll Providers For Small Businesses

As a small business owner, managing payroll can be a daunting task. From calculating employee wages to ensuring compliance with tax laws, payroll can take up valuable time and resources that could be better spent on growing your business. That’s where payroll providers come in – they can help streamline the payroll process, freeing up your time to focus on more important aspects of your business.

When it comes to choosing a payroll provider for your small business, there are a few key factors to consider. These include cost, ease of use, level of customer support, and features offered. To help you make an informed decision, we’ve compiled a list of some of the top payroll providers for small businesses.

1. ADP

ADP is one of the largest and most well-known payroll providers in the world. They offer a wide range of payroll services for small businesses, including online payroll processing, tax filing, and direct deposit. ADP’s payroll solutions are user-friendly and intuitive, making it easy for small business owners to manage their payroll efficiently. With 24/7 customer support and a dedicated account manager, ADP provides top-notch service to its clients.

2. Gusto

Gusto is a popular payroll provider for small businesses, known for its affordable pricing and user-friendly interface. With Gusto, small business owners can easily set up and manage payroll, benefits, and HR tasks all in one place. Gusto also handles tax filings and payments, saving small business owners time and reducing the risk of costly errors. In addition, Gusto offers excellent customer support, including live chat and phone support.

3. Paychex

Paychex is another well-established payroll provider that caters to small businesses. They offer a range of payroll services, including payroll processing, tax administration, and employee benefits. Paychex’s online platform is easy to use and customizable, allowing small business owners to tailor their payroll solutions to meet their specific needs. Paychex also offers a variety of additional services, such as time and attendance tracking and employee onboarding.

4. Intuit QuickBooks Payroll

Intuit QuickBooks Payroll is a popular choice for small businesses that already use QuickBooks for their accounting needs. With Intuit QuickBooks Payroll, small business owners can seamlessly import payroll data into their accounting software, saving time and reducing the risk of errors. Intuit QuickBooks Payroll offers a range of payroll services, including direct deposit, tax filing, and employee benefits. They also offer excellent customer support, with phone and chat support available to assist small business owners with any questions or issues.

5. Square Payroll

Square Payroll is a comprehensive payroll solution designed specifically for small businesses. With Square Payroll, small business owners can easily set up and manage payroll, tax filings, and employee benefits. Square Payroll’s online platform is intuitive and user-friendly, making it easy for small business owners to stay on top of their payroll tasks. In addition, Square Payroll offers transparent pricing with no hidden fees, making it a cost-effective option for small businesses.
